从图像的一部分(PHP)解码QRCode

时间:2019-06-17 14:26:46

标签: php qr-code

我正在使用https://github.com/khanamiryan/php-qrcode-detector-decoder中的Zxing库

当我尝试从左上角包含它的图像扫描和解码QR码时,我得到:

致命错误:在/ var / www / clients / client1 / web4 / web / eas / vendor / khanamiryan / qrcode-detector-decoder / lib / IMagickLuminanceSource中,已用完的内存容量268435456字节(尝试分配268435464字节)。第60行的PHP

我试图将memory_limit增加到1024M,但是没有任何变化。

我可以使用相同的在线工具https://zxing.org/w/decode.jspx解码相同的文件

//read qr code here
$qrcode = new QrReader(__DIR__ . "/omr/exams_scanned/" . $paper);
$qrpaper = $qrcode->text();
echo $qrpaper;

我希望看到与仅使用QR码扫描图像相同的结果。它可以工作,但是如果它只停留在纸张的一小部分,它就能找到QR码。

0 个答案:

没有答案